Abstract
New supramolecular cation structures of (4-fluoroanilinium)([18]crown-6) and (4-methylanilinium)([18]crown-6) were introduced as counter cations to [Ni(dmit)2]- salts, which bear an S = 1/2 spin, to form magnetic crystals. From the crystal structures and temperature dependent magnetic susceptibilities, both salts had isomorphous structure of one-dimensional arrangements of [Ni(dmit)2]- π-dimer along the b-axis. The magnetic ground state of these salts was spin singlet with the intradimer magnetic exchange energy of around -150 K.
